Re: General UK Visa Enquiries - Part 5 by Thegamingorca(m): 12:34pm On Apr 04
Internationalmu:
Please how can one explain inflow for monthly contribution in uk application, is it savings or additional source of income?


Monthly contribution kuma?!


Pls all these things will only serve to raise eyebrows which will lead to you being looked at skeptically for any dodgy mistakes .

What the heck is a monthly contribution?! Make your bank statement clean by ensuring only your salary and the small chops you withdraw occasionally along the month for expenses should be what is factored in your bank statement.



Ofcourse you must provide document. If it is a gift from your employer, go the extra mile and draft a letter with letter headed addressed to UkVI Sheffield office, clearly stating the income is not lodgement but allowance you are due on a monthly basis.
Re: General UK Visa Enquiries - Part 5 by Cashmadam: 12:48pm On Apr 04
tony2478:
@Cashmadam,
Please if my employer should transfer the trip sponsorship fund of like 3.5m to fully cover my trip to a business conference two weeks before my biometric,I hope it will fly.

I will submit my Salary account where I have been receiving my salary for the past 6 months and also submit my employers account for the past 6 months as well.

2. In the online form which says How much are you personally spending on this trip? Can I put N1 naira,since my Employer is providing all the funds for the trip.

Please Cashmadam and other gurus respond to a brother

No need to transfer any funds into your account. Provide your statements of account and proof that your employer is willing and able to sponsor the trip. The money transferred can appear like "account padding" if you are not careful.
